The Night (Al-Layl)
In the name of Allah, the Compassionate, the Merciful
By the night enshrouding 1 and the day as it rises bright! 2 And the creating of the male and the female, 3 O men, you truly strive towards the most diverse ends! 4 As for him who giveth and is dutiful (toward Allah) 5 And believeth in goodness; 6 We will facilitate for him the easy end. 7 But as for him who is a miser, and self-sufficient, 8 and rejects what is right, 9 for him shall We make easy the path towards hardship: 10 And what will his wealth avail him when he falls? 11 Surely, in Our hands is guidance, 12 and to Us belong the Last and the First. 13 So, I warn you of the blazing Fire. 14 where none shall burn except the most wicked, 15 He who denieth and turneth away. 16 And Al-Muttaqun (the pious and righteous - see V. 2:2) will be far removed from it (Hell). 17 even he who gives his wealth. to purify himself 18 not as payment for favours received, 19 Except the seeking of the pleasure of his Lord, the Most High. 20 And presently he shall become well pleased. 21
